Zabezpiecz hasłem plik Excela za pomocą interfejsu API REST Pythona

W tym podstawowym temacie dowiesz się, jak zabezpieczyć hasłem plik Excel za pomocą interfejsu API REST Pythona. Stworzymy aplikację do szyfrowania pliku Excela za pomocą interfejsu API Python Cloud, postępując zgodnie ze szczegółowymi i przejrzystymi krokami opisanymi w poniższej sekcji. Wygenerowaną aplikację można zintegrować z dowolną aplikacją obsługującą Pythona w systemach macOS, Linux lub Windows, a konwersja jest bezpłatna.

Warunek wstępny

Kroki szyfrowania pliku Excel za pomocą interfejsu API Python Low Code

  1. Skonfiguruj identyfikator klienta i klucz tajny klienta dla interfejsu API, aby zaszyfrować skoroszyt hasłem za pomocą interfejsu API REST języka Python
  2. Utwórz klasę CellsApi z danymi uwierzytelniającymi klienta, aby zabezpieczyć plik XLS hasłem
  3. Określ nazwy plików źródłowych XLS i załaduj plik źródłowy XLS, używając nazwy i obiektu pliku w HashMap
  4. Utwórz obiekt ProtectWorkbookRequest, aby ustawić hasło i inne właściwości
  5. Utwórz instancję PostProtectRequest, aby ustawić pliki mapy i instancję ProtectWorkbookRequest
  6. Wywołaj metodę żądania PostProtect, aby zaszyfrować plik Excela przy użyciu interfejsu API Python low code
  7. Zapisz plik/pliki Excel chronione hasłem na dysku lokalnym

Powyższe kroki pozwalają na zabezpieczenie hasłem programu Excel za pomocą interfejsu REST API języka Python. Rozpoczniemy proces od konfiguracji zestawu SDK i utworzenia instancji klasy CellsAPI. Następnie otworzymy źródłowe pliki XLS za pomocą obiektu HashMap i utworzymy instancje klas ProtectWorkbookRequest i PostProtectRequest, które następnie zostaną użyte do ustawienia zabezpieczenia hasłem plików programu Excel za pomocą metody PostProtect().

Kod do ochrony hasłem programu Excel za pomocą interfejsu API REST języka Python

Ten prosty przykładowy kod umożliwia zabezpieczenie hasłem programu Excel za pomocą interfejsu API Python low code. Należy podać pliki źródłowe programu Excel i hasło do zabezpieczenia, a także inne opcjonalne właściwości. Po utworzeniu komunikatu żądania, funkcja PostProtect() zabezpiecza plik Excel i zwraca zabezpieczone hasłem pliki Excel, które można zapisać na dysku lub w bazie danych.

We have explored to encrypt Workbook with Password using Python REST API in this article. If you want to explore Excel to PNG conversion, refer to the article on how to Convert Excel to PNG with Python REST API.

 Polski